THE 5 SUPPLIES YOU’LL NEED FOR SHIPPING CHEESE - THE ...
Jul 17, 2018 · Now that your box is insulated and your cheese is prepped, it’s time to put it all together. Layer cold packs into the bottom of your insulated box, add a layer of bubble cushion and place the cheese inside. From here, fill up the rest of the box with void fill—biodegradable packing peanuts are a good choice.

BEST WAY TO SHIP FROZEN FOOD CHEAPLY: SHIPPING PERISHABLE ...
Mar 08, 2019 · The best way to ship frozen food is to make sure the items are thoroughly frozen before placing them in the box. Keep them in the freezer and completely frozen until the last possible moment before shipping them. This will maximize the amount of time they’ll stay frozen during transport.
